all repos — infra @ 3b44bec47bda26a24c36599f52f8637ca1c06414

infrastructure manifests and setup notes

apps/vaultwarden/config.yaml (view raw)

 1
 2
 3
 4
 5
 6
 7
 8
 9
 10
 11
 12
 13
 14
 15
 16
 17
 18
 19
 20
 21
 22
 23
 24
 25
 26
 27
 28
 29
 30
 31
 32
 33
 34
 35
 36
 37
 38
 39
 40
 41
 42
 43
 44
 45
 46
 47
 48
 49
apiVersion: v1
data:
  DISABLE_ADMIN_TOKEN: "true"
  ADMIN_RATELIMIT_MAX_BURST: "3"
  ADMIN_RATELIMIT_SECONDS: "300"
  DATA_FOLDER: /data
  DATABASE_MAX_CONNS: "10"
  DB_CONNECTION_RETRIES: "15"
  DOMAIN: http://pass.koti.lan
  EMAIL_CHANGE_ALLOWED: "true"
  EMERGENCY_ACCESS_ALLOWED: "true"
  EMERGENCY_NOTIFICATION_REMINDER_SCHEDULE: 0 3 * * * *
  EMERGENCY_REQUEST_TIMEOUT_SCHEDULE: 0 7 * * * *
  EXTENDED_LOGGING: "true"
  ICON_BLACKLIST_NON_GLOBAL_IPS: "true"
  ICON_REDIRECT_CODE: "302"
  ICON_SERVICE: internal
  INVITATION_EXPIRATION_HOURS: "120"
  INVITATION_ORG_NAME: Vaultwarden
  INVITATIONS_ALLOWED: "true"
  IP_HEADER: X-Real-IP
  LOG_TIMESTAMP_FORMAT: "%Y-%m-%d %H:%M:%S.%3f"
  ORG_EVENTS_ENABLED: "false"
  ORG_GROUPS_ENABLED: "false"
  PUSH_ENABLED: "true"
  PUSH_IDENTITY_URI: https://identity.bitwarden.eu
  PUSH_INSTALLATION_ID: 9f08a610-b413-4e6b-b07c-b1b9008435dc
  PUSH_INSTALLATION_KEY: HY8uowMTFT9GgbcSfPMF
  PUSH_RELAY_URI: https://api.bitwarden.eu
  REQUIRE_DEVICE_EMAIL: "false"
  ROCKET_ADDRESS: 0.0.0.0
  ROCKET_PORT: "8080"
  ROCKET_WORKERS: "10"
  SENDS_ALLOWED: "false"
  SHOW_PASSWORD_HINT: "false"
  SIGNUPS_ALLOWED: "true"
  SIGNUPS_VERIFY: "true"
  TRASH_AUTO_DELETE_DAYS: ""
  TZ: Europe/Helsinki
  WEB_VAULT_ENABLED: "true"
  WEBSOCKET_ENABLED: "false"
kind: ConfigMap
metadata:
  labels:
    app.kubernetes.io/component: vaultwarden
    app.kubernetes.io/instance: vaultwarden
    app.kubernetes.io/name: vaultwarden
  name: vaultwarden
  namespace: default